I did an upgrade via the "From ftp or http URL" option - Somewhat easier than going into the shell for most users... /Jeppe Uhd - nx.dk > This is a bug in Webmin 1.470 - it is fixed in the 1.480 and later > releases, but > unfortunately you can't do an auto-upgrade to that version! > > The fix is to manually download and install Webmin 1.490, by following the > regular > install process. > > On Debian, this should just be a matter of fetching the latest .deb file > and running : > > dpkg --install webmin_1.490_all.deb > > - Jamie > > On 22/Sep/2009 02:34 da...@da... wrote .. >> Hello Jamie, the Webmin upgrade works from one server but not another >> (different >> Linux flavors). This has happened a couple of times in the past. >> Particulars follow. >> Please advise, David. >> >> ************************* >> Upgrade failed >> ************************* >> >> System hostname webitplanet.com >> Operating system Debian Linux 3.1 >> Webmin version 1.470 >> Time on system Tue Sep 22 04:24:24 2009 >> Kernel and CPU Linux 2.4.27-2-386 on i686 >> >> Downloading http://www.webmin.com/cgi-bin/redirect.cgi/upgrade/ (263 >> bytes) .. >> Failed to upgrade from www.webmin.com : Missing Location header >> >> ************************** >> Upgrade succeeded >> ************************** >> >> System hostname davidwbrown.name >> Operating system CentOS Linux 5.2 >> Webmin version 1.490 >> Time on system Tue Sep 22 04:31:21 2009 >> Kernel and CPU Linux 2.6.18-92.1.22.el5xen on i686 >> >> >> >> Jamie Cameron <jca...@we...> wrote .. >> > Hi everyone, >> > >> > Webmin version 1.490 is now available for download from >> > http://www.webmin.com/ .
